Data recovery after android factory reset
Luckily, Factory Reset does not clean your data and it could be recovered after making some efforts. Factory Reset actually marks files on your device as deleted or hidden.
If you want to recover data, you should stop using your smart phone as the first measure. Using or adding new files will consume the space left due to your pre-existing deleted files and will overwrite over those deleted files. Thus, recovering those deleted files will become impossible then.

In order to free you hard disk from viruses, you need to take the following steps:
1. When you attach your USB drive to the system, the same windows shown below will be seen
2. You need not click OK, click Cancel.
3. Type ’çmd’ in the run box to open the Command Prompt.
4. Enter inside the drive, by typing the “drive letter:” and pressing enter.
5. Now give the command dir/w/a and press enter.
A list of all the files in the pen drive will be shown. You have to check for the presence of following files:
Ravmon.exe
svchost.exe
Autorun.inf
Heap41a
New Folder.exe
Or any exe file which might be unreliable.
7. The presence of any of these files shows that the system is infected.
8. Type “attrib -r -a -s -h *.*” and press enter in the Command Prompt.
9. By doing this, all the Read Only, Archive, System and Hidden file traits will be removed from all the files.
10. Finally, files can be deleted by typing the command “del filename” and pressing enter.

Clean Registry for an Effective Computer Tune-Up: The Windows registry is a necessary database on your computer that stores settings for Microsoft Windows operating system and every single act performed on the system. It includes information for all type of hardware, software, and preferences settings on your computer. Whenever you change settings in the "Control Panel", system policies, or software, the changes are stored in the registry.
Since your registry is huge and complicated, it can develop difficulties that cause strange problems to your PC and bring about a halt. The longer you use Windows, the more chaotic your registry becomes, especially if you regularly install and uninstall software. All the remnants of applications cannot be eliminated when you uninstall them. Such registry entries can cause problems such as slow performance, system lockups, or a bloated registry that consumes time to load.

The term 32 bit or 64 bit system refers to the computer processor (also called a CPU) that contains information. The 64 bit processor handles extensively large data or memory (Random Access Memory) and is more effective than the 32-bit system.
How to differentiate whether your system is running a 32-bit or a 64-bit version of Windows?
If there is no label to explicitly tell you which 32 / 64) bit it is, perform the following steps to identify whether your computer is running a 32 bit processor or a 64 bit processor:
Click the Start button, right click on Computer, and then select Properties.
Below System, you can view the specifications of your computer.
If you are a Windows XP user, perform the following:
Go to Start.
Right click My Computer, and then select Properties.
If you are unable to view "x64 Edition" on the list, then you are operating on Windows XP
But if you see "x64 Edition" among the listed in the System, then you are running a 64 bit version of Windows XP.
Confused which of the two should be installed?
In order to install a 64 bit Operating System you need to have a CPU that has the capability to run and support the functioning of a 64 bit version of Windows. The benefit of using a 64 bit processor can only be achieved if you are using a large amount of Random Access Memory (RAM), around 4GB or more installed on your computer. Hence a 64 bit operating system is capable of handling large amount of data more efficiently than a 32 bit operating system. A 64-bit system is more efficient and responsive if you are working on multiple applications simultaneously or switching between multiple applications frequently.
Is it possible to run a 32-bit program on a 64-bit computer?
Yes absolutely. Most programs that are designed on a 32 bit operating system runs perfectly on a 64 bit computer. However, there are some exceptions as in software applications which might not perform well.
However you have to keep in mind that device drivers that are designed on a 32 bit operating system will not run on a 64 bit computer. If you want to install a printer that has only 32 bit drivers available on a 64 bit computer, then it will not work on a 64 bit system. To know more about the drivers, go to Update a driver for hardware that isn't working properly or of visit the manufacturer website.
Is it possible to run a 64-bit program on a 32-bit computer?
If the program is designed specifically for 64 bit operating system then you won’t be able to operate it on a 32 bit system. (However there are still some 64 bit programs that can run on a 32 bit computer).

As a result of researches done in Cornell University, fake reviews have some characteristic features. By making a note of these, figuring out the authenticity is easy.
Use of a lot of exaggerations. The use of phrases like ‘must-read’, ‘life-changing’, ‘become billionaire’, etc., to lure or misguide the readers is common.
Focus more on references. Rather than giving their own experience of the product and services, reviewer tends to point other people, like ‘My friends experience’, ‘Raw dealing with my brother’, etc.
Extensive use of singular first person. Words like ‘me’, ‘I’ etc., are used more than required to make the review look more credible.
Use of exclamatory marks and positive emotions. If you notice ‘Hurray!’, ‘Ah!’, etc., in the review, chances are, they are fake, because real reviews, use of other types of punctuations and not just comma.
